Skinhead

Skinhead (of the words English skin { skin } and head { head }: shaven ) designates in the beginning a young person British Prolétaire with shaven cranium.

Already during the English Civil war (1642-1649), the partisans of the Parliament carried out by Oliver Cromwell were called the round Têtes by their enemies because of their short cut opposed to long hair of the aristocrats in favor of king Charles Ier Stuart. The resemblance to the skinheads stops there because the partisans of Cromwell, even if they recruited much among the popular classes, were above all the puritan Protestants who refused the claims absolutists of the king and the possibility of a re-establishment of Catholicism in England.

There would be also mention of individuals answering the definition and the name of the skinhead at the beginning of the 20th century in the press of the United Kingdom. The term designated young hooligans resulting from the poor districts to the short hair, the equivalent of the " Apaches of the zone" in France. Nevertheless, in its modern meaning, the skinhead term applies to a Youth movement born at the end of the Années 1960 in the United Kingdom.

Of Mods in Skinheads

Skinheads result from vagueness modernist : after 1967 much of Mods transfer towards the flower power and the Psychédélisme. Some preserve the original style and radicalize their look: they are the hardware mods , or heavy mods . They carry the curved costume and the hat pork-magpie to dance, but of the sport clothing or work to trail in the street (sports shirt Fred Perry, shoes Doc. Martens black and waxed well with white laces…). They take the opposite course to the connected mode of the time (the such psychedelic wave or the movement Hippie), reject the Conformisme and post their working origins proudly ( working class ). These hardware mods is contracted on the identity modernist of the period 1962 - 1966: American negro music (drunk person), Italian luxury (Dolce vita), urban and modern style, scooters Vespa or Lambretta

As they live in same the suburbs and working districts, the hardware mods attend the Rude servant boys , or rudies , young immigrants West-Indian, especially jamaïcains, to which the look is close and with which they share the taste for the American negro music (Soul, rythm' blues) and jamaïcaine (Ska and Rocksteady). Towards 1968 the hardware mods and the rudies merge to become the skinheads . Some claim that they mowed the hair to be distinguished from the hippies. Or because number of them worked in factory, to carry the short hair raised of a standard to avoid the incidents in contact with the machines. More probably, it is about a means to escape the police force assembled at the time of the riots. The look skinhead is standardized quickly: short hair (mowed or crossed short, but seldom shaven with white at that time), favorites, sports shirt style Fred Perry, shirt style Ben Sherman, straps, jeans style short Levis 501 crossed or pants adjusted standard Sta Close (rejection of the legs of elephant), shoes Doc. Martens, rangers or tennis shoes, wind-breaker style Bombers jacket, harrington or donkey jacket (coat of docker), scarf of its preferred football club… Let us note that the wind-breaker harrington, carried by the mods, then the skinheads and finally the punks, is not a mark but a type of light jacket in plain fabric of cotton doubled of fabrics with squares Scot (tartan). The name comes from the hero of the American televised series " Peyton Places " , very popular at the beginning of the Years 1960, Mr. Harrington, who wore this clothing. The look skinhead is thus a mixture of sportswear, working clotheses and surpluses military. But the adjusted costume, heritage modernist, are still carried to dance or brag in evening. These teenagers and these young adults adapt themselves, like those of today, certain marks becoming emblematic: Fred Perry, Lonsdale, Ben Sherman, Everlast, or Adidas

1969, Skinheads popularize the reggae

In 1969, a true tidal wave skinhead invades the United Kingdom. This counter-culture becomes suddenly very with the mode and links the young people of the working districts, as well white as black. The skinheads listen of the drunk person, the rythm' blues (of the labels Stax, Motown or Chess records), of the mod' S happy (British drunk person-rock'n'roll of the Who and other Kinks or Small Faces), but especially of the Ska, the rocksteady and the reggae with black artists come from the the Caribbean such Simaryp, Laurel Aitken, Desmond Dekker and even the Skatalites, the Upsetters, Jimmy Cliff or Bob Marley, Wailers… The reggae and the rocksteady, much more than the ska almost passed of mode in 1969, seem the sound skinhead par excellence. For the purists, one speaks then about skinhead reggae , reggae one drop or of early reggae . In the tradition modernist, the skinheads like to dance. They compete of steps of dance complicated to brag at the time of the discoes , the equivalent of the booms Frenchwomen. The songs speak about their daily life: riots, difficulties of the working condition, problems of the every day, social dispute, but also sex, dance and football. The principal recording companies editors of ska and skinhead reggae in the United Kingdom are Trojan Records and Pama Records. The logo Trojan (a helmet of Trojan warrior) was taken again thereafter to indicate the original skinheads ( spirit off 69 ). The girls are called skinhead girls rather than birds or birdies (term pejorative are equivalent of French " pouffiasse").

These gangs of young people have sometimes a behavior violate and the Hooligan S quickly adopt the vestimentary style of the skinheads. Some advance that the skinheads result from hooliganism. They is at the same time true and false: the young British of the middle-classes and popular often behave in hooligans in the football stadiums, but hooliganism is older than the style skinhead (it dates from the beginning of the 20th century) and the vestimentary codes of the hooligans vary much with the modes (the majority of the current hooligans do not have absolutely the look skinhead). The abuse alcohol and various Drogue S (especially the Amphetamine S to be able to dance all during the night, LSD being rather a fashion of Hippie S) does not arrange anything with the image skinheads. The press tabloïd can consequently stigmatize the skinheads, as it had done before for the mods or the rockers . It is the new threat.

The frequent use of the national colors (Union Jack for the whole of the British or Holy Georges Cross-country race for the English) by the skinheads of this time is wrongly interpreted as a slip towards nationalism. In fact the young British often show a patriotism jingoist such as one can meet it in the platforms of the football stadiums. It is not generally founded on any nationalism in a strict sense. The mods before raised the national colors and the punks thereafter will make in the same way. Also let us note that the British pavoisent much more frequently than the French. This pride to belong to the British nation is even a unifying element for the young white British and the black West-Indians come from Jamaica or St Lucia (states of the Commonwealth, whose inhabitants are compared to the British since subjects of the same queen).

But it is true that the skinheads of this time are proof of mistrust in the opposition, not of the Blacks, but of the young Indians and Pakistani, whose vestimentary style and the musical tastes bring them closer to the hippies. Some organize true Ratonnade S in their opposition: the paki bashing . Those react and found gangs of skinhead scalpers . This opposition between skinheads black and white on the one hand and young people indo-Pakistani of the other was however never a general information at the time of the first skinhead wave. It is rather a circumscribed reality with certain districts of London and especially with certain gangs. Besides the files of time show many skinheads with the Asian type.

This first skinhead wave thus before a a whole mode, a musical and vestimentary style is largely ignored out of the United Kingdom. There is practically no skinheads at that time in continental Europe or North America. At most the vestimentary fashion skinhead it had some echoes in May 68. In an amusing way, in the film " Everyone it is beautiful, everyone it is gentil" (1970), the actor Jean Yanne carries during some sequences a behavior inspired by the skinhead fashion: tightened Jean with reverse, fitted wind-breaker of the same fabric, rangers, hair plated and favorite. For the majority of the British journalists the skinheads are only one new kind of unverifiable hooligans (at the time France has its black wind-breakers). The movement or is not politicized little.

About 1971 the skinhead wave is blown. Novel modes appear: the style Glam rock'n'roll for the young white and the Movement rastafari for the blacks. The authentic skinheads, which reject racism and free violence, adopt the style suedehead (velvet cranium): the look becomes more required, with the manner of the mods, the hair push back.

1979, Skinheads reappear then are politicized

After 1971 the skinhead spirit does not disappear therefore and survives through the suedeheads then the smoothies (these-last carry the rather long hair). Both adopt the style bootboy when they go down in the street: rolled up jeans, rising Doc. Marten' S, straps… It is the vestimentary style raised in film of Stanley Kubrick " Clockwork orange ". Work is violent but the message is more subtle than it does not appear to with it: a criticism of the behaviorist theories and a caricature of the most ridiculous aspects of the modern societies. After this film a source of inspiration for many skinheads groups will constitute, contributing to forge the image of the young violent, unverifiable but cynically lucid rebel.

The mods them also are Has-been but remain numerous, in particular in the north of England where they are at the origin of a particular musical style, influenced by the American negro music of the years 1960, the northern drunk .

The musical codes change and at the bootboys the reggae, the rocksteady and the ska are quickly supplanted by the glam rock'n'roll (cf David Bowie or The New York Dolls), the pub rock'n'roll (cf Dr. Feelgood and Elvis Costello) then the punk-rock'n'roll (musical genre invented in the United States by the Stooges, the New York Dolls, still them, and the Ramones, born in 1974 and famous since 1976). Number of the British first Punk S (end 1976-beginning 1977) have the style bootboy , to start with the Clash (in addition fans of reggae and pub rock'n'roll).

Benefitting from the media explosion punk in 1977, the skinheads and even the mods reappears and mixes with the punks . They very few, are then drowned in the punk mass. The film Quadrophenia (1979) and groups it The Jam take part in the revival of the current modernist . The hybridization of the mods and the punks bears the name of hardware-mods (begun again of a term already used at the end of the years 1960). After 1979 however, the punk-rock'n'roll does not have any more the favor of the media of mass and the look punk is radicalized: the punks become not dead (of the expression “punk' S not dead”). It is the time when hobnailed wind-breakers and coloured peaks appear. However much of punks of the first wave adopt the style of the skinheads, which passes at the same time like a return to the sources and a toughening. The movement skinhead knows a new hour of mediatization.

These new skinheads listens to or plays of the street punk and the oi!, i.e. violent and radical forms of punk-rock'n'roll. Oi! , in slang cockney, is the contraction of the apostrophe: Hey you! . One hears Oi! for the first time on a piece of the Clash in 1977 ( Career opportunities ). The precursory groups are Menace, Angelic Upstarts or Sham 69, then come Cockney Rejects, Business, Cocksparrers, The 4 Skins, Last Resort, The Oppressed, Blitz

Sham 69, group emblematic of the skinheads (and always on the road) never adopted a radical look skinhead (the singer carries the semi-long hair). The videos of end of the year 1970 show rather the very frequent look bootboy at that time. The members of Blitz or Oppressed post as for them an appearance skinhead more standardized much (mowed hair, ankle boots, straps…). Exploited reveal the street-punk look, basically different from that of the skinheads but with similarities: cuts iroquoises (peaks), hobnailed leather jackets, grinding cartridge pouches and pants deviate from the look skinhead. One notes here (except for the hair) an osmosis with the style heavy very extravagant metal of the time. But the punks not dead carry also turned up straps, jeans and ankle boots like the skinheads. The punks seem to prefer the rangers and the skinheads coquées Docs Martens or the paraboots (generic term to indicate the boots of jump, the most known mark being Getta Grip). The intermediate looks between the punk one and the skinhead are indicated under the terms bootboys , skunks or herberts . These nuances appear futile to the neophyte. But it should be understood that at the punks like the skinheads vestimentary appearance, the haircut and the pace in general have a considerable importance. The majority are teenagers or young adults who seek with émanciper and are thus very attentive with the vestimentary codes.

This time knows also a revival rocksteady, ska and skinhead reggae which contributes to popularize the style skinhead with groups like Madness, The Specials, Bad Manners or The Selecter at Two-Ton Records. These musicians adopt a vestimentary style rather modernist or hardware mods , but the public is largely skinhead. Many artists jamaïcains fallen into the lapse of memory remake surface (for example the singer Laurel Aitken, godfather off ska music , or the trombonist Rico Rodriguez). The ska, energized by the punk-rock'n'roll influences, gains the favors of the public skinhead of the time.

But in 1979, contrary to 1969, the very great majority of the skinheads are white. It is as of this time as date the practice to shave the hair and the Oi music! from this time is often described as closed shave (shaven of near). The slogan ACAB ( all the cops are bastards , " all the cops are bâtards") fact its appearance. Since 1979 the skinhead fashion exceeds the United Kingdom and touches North America and Western Europe (in France the first skin-punk compilation Chaos leaves in 1982). It is a particularly long-lived counter-culture in the years 1980, even if it does not attract the majority of the young people. In France, thepunk one of the Camera silens or the Mouse Déglinguée attracts a public skinhead. The same applies to Skarface, legend alive of the ska to France. In New York the inventors of the punk-hardcore music are generally skinheads (Agnostic Front, Madball, MOD,…), and assert still today their membership of the movement. These skinheads evolves/moves in a broader mobility: punk-rock'n'roll, the hardcore or alternative rock'n'roll.

This second time skinhead is also marked by the political recovery of the movement. At the end of the years 1970 the Extrême British right wing (National British Party and National Face) is established among the white young people punks and skinheads resulting generally from the most disadvantaged social classes and in situation from marginalisation. The provocations of some punks, as Sid Vicious which often raised a tee-shirt to swastika, made think of some that rebellious truths were the Nazis. Ian Stuart, singer of the punk group Skrewdriver, is a typical example of this drift. Skrewdriver was a street group punk perfectly apolitical (like the vast majority of the punks groups at that time), but particularly provocative, born in 1977. After Split of short duration Ian Stuart reconstitutes the group in 1979, but in a openly politicized form néonazie, then it creates Blood and Honor with the beginning of the year 1980. It is a nationalist movement, racist and in particular anti-semite. Ian Stuart does not hide its fascination for Hitler and is not long in giving directly its support for associations néonazies, as well in the United Kingdom as to Germany. It is followed by part of the skinheads which adopt an increasingly violent behavior and rock towards the extreme line. Much is hooligans fascinated by violence in all its forms. They howl Sieg Heil! or Heil Hitler in the concerts and starts frequent brawls with the others skinheads or the punks, without speaking about the aggressions towards the blacks or the immigrants. The paki bashing begins again.

Some skinheads could approach the extreme-right-hand side to take the opposite course to the punks to the period 1979-1982: rejection of dirtiness, the look " destroy" badly shaved, of reducing to beggary, anarchism bawler, the hard drugs… respect of the family values, work, the fatherland, healthy and clean pace physical and vestimentary… I.e. the rejection of the marginalisation and attachment with at the same time popular and preserving values. Ideologically these nationalist first skinheads rake very broad: survivors of the British Nazism of the Thirties which serve mentors, anti-semites of any hair, xenophobes scalded by immigration, anticommunists who denounce the Soviet states, hooligans violentissimes, punks and skinheads deprived of ideological reference marks which like to cause while raising badges Nazis (whereas their parents often fought the Nazis in 1939-45)…

Nauseated by this recovery of their counter-culture and faithful to their mongrel roots, the skinheads antiracists gather as from 1979-80 in Skinheads Against the Nazis (S.A.N., impelled and controlled by Socialist Worker' S Party, trotskist), then within SHARP ( SkinHeads Against Racial Damage , movement founded in New York about 1987 starting from the experiment since 1985 of a group of skinheads and boot-servant boys of Cincinnati called Baldies Against Racism). The emblematic figure of movement SHARP is Roddy Moreno, leader of the Welsh group The Oppressed and importer in 1989 of the SHARP in the United Kingdom. The Oppressed sing Work together (wink Marxist with the " Proletarians of all the countries, you link! "). But before " avoid-feux" do not start to function, the image skinheads and even certain groups emblematic of the scene had to suffer from the drift towards the neonazism of a part of them. Thus the Sham 69, desperate that many skinheads of extrème-right-hand side attends their concerts (the " SHAM Army" , troop of fans of the group, being even gangrénée by those). Its mythical singer Jimmy Pursey then decides to give the pendulums per hour while making play the group in festivals RAR (Rock'n'roll Against Racism). The Sham 69 adapt the Chilean revolutionary song El pueblo unido jamas will be vencido (the plain people will never be overcome) in If the kids are united they will never Be defeated (If the kids are linked, they will never be beaten). These groups reaffirm their pride to belong to the working class and to share its values: fraternity, solidarity, social struggles… At the same time the Dead Kennedys (Punk group Californian) denounce the drift of the punks and skinheads Nazis in the piece Nazi punks. Fuck off! . Some skinheads antiracists are engaged within Socialist Workers Party, Marxist organization revolutionary which organizes great strikes as from 1980 in reaction to the liberal policy of the Thatcher government (called into question of social skills, doulouleuses reorganizations in industry and the mines…). They are called reds (red) by the nationalists who show them to want to make rock the Occident in the Soviet sphere (makes the majority of the skinheads antiracists of it are close to British socialism or the trade unionism reformist, more rarely of Communism). Besides true the redskins , close to the revolutionary left, constitutes in the beginning (around the group of drunk person-rock'n'roll The Redskins animated by the permanent ones of the SWP) a movement distinct from the skinheads. The skinheads antiracists consider the nationalists and the néonazis like forgery skinheads and call literally them Bonehead S (" craniums of os" , makes the English equivalent of " of it; crétin"). These two terms, pejorative in the spirit of those which use them, always have course today.

Skinheads today

Today the mobility of the skinheads is deeply divided and heteroclite. The neophyte will have great difficulty to decide between them, more especially as the vestimentary codes are similar in spite of very different political tendencies. The culture skinhead is founded on a musical support. The reading of the songs, the imagery of the small pockets of disc, the labels of distribution, production, the posted logos or slogans often make it possible to locate the artists politically.

The skinheads are in fact with the image of the company: their political sensibility goes from the Extrême right-hand side to the Extreme left while passing by the left and the right traditional. Some are democratic, whereas others are attracted by radical speeches which preach the Dictatorship of the proletariat of the Marxist-Leninist type, or contrary a dictatorship of the National-Socialist type. Some are radically racist, whereas others reject in very standard block of racism. Some are atheistic or agnostic, whereas others are believers (Christian, pagan, Buddhist)…

In spite of this diversity, there are common points which gather them (almost) all: they result generally from the modest or average social classes, and are proud their social origins. They scorn with vitality the police force, the middle-class men and the hippies (still that the contempt of the hippies resembles more one play than with a real hatred in certain bands). They generally support the football team of their city and optionnellement their national team. Their taste for the provocation and the brawl gathers them too. In the same way, they adore déhancher on the tracks of dance at the time of evenings 60 ' S with the sound of the musics mods, drunk person or jamaïcaines - except the skinheads néonazis -, go pogoter at the time of concerts streetpunk, oi! (or RAC for the néonazis). Lastly, the skinheads are also very active in the drafting and the diffusion of fanzines dedicated to the music, football and other cultures (like tattooing or the scooter for example).

Conclusion

It should be retained that the first skinheads appeared at the end of the years 1960 and that they were not to in no case racist or fascistic, nor Communists, therefore not politicized besides. Their common point was their modest social origin, their love of the negro music and their taste for the brawl. It is with the appearance of the Punk-rock'n'roll in 1977 and the unemployment which strikes full whip Europe at the end of the Années 1970, that the movement skinhead politicizes mainly. It is the beginning of the great opposition between the scenes skinheads of extreme-right-hand side and extreme-left, the first being in particular allured by the texts néonazis of the second formation of the British group Skrewdriver, and the seconds by groups like The Clash or The Oppressed.
